Solaris Healthcare Parkway
Solaris Healthcare Parkway is a 3-star rated nursing home in Stuart, FL with 177 beds. CMS sub-ratings: health inspections 3/5, staffing 4/5, quality measures 3/5.
The facility has 31 health violations on record. Most recent inspection: June 6, 2024.
